Škoda Auto India launches Slavia Style Edition in exclusive numbers
This car will be available in very limited numbers of only 500 units.

MUMBAI
In what is its first product action after achieving one lakh sales in two years, Škoda Auto India has introduced the Slavia Style Edition of its best-selling, five-star safe, crash-tested sedan. Speaking on the product, Petr Janeba, Brand Director, Škoda Auto India, said: “The Slavia Style Edition is yet another instance of us listening to our discerning customers and offering an extremely exclusive, yet high value product for our customers. It comes in very limited numbers, for a very focussed set of our customers, but will be accessible across our 200-plus sales touchpoints across India.” The equipment The Style Edition is slotted above the top-of-the-line Style variant of the Slavia. It comes standard with features like a Dual Dash Camera. It hosts an ‘Edition’ badge on the blacked-out B-pillars, black mirror covers and a Black Roof Foil. Inside, customers are greeted by a ‘Slavia’ branded Scuff Plate with the steering carrying an ‘Edition’ badge. Stepping out of the car will reveal a Puddle Lamp with the Brand Logo Projection. The exclusivity Škoda Auto India will launch 500 units of the Style Edition of the Slavia. All 500 will come exclusively with the 1.5 TSI engine mated to the 7-speed DSG
